Paracryptops is a genus of centipedes in the family Cryptopidae. It was described in 1891 by British myriapodologist Reginald Innes Pocock.[1][2]
Species
There are five valid species:[2]
- Paracryptops breviunguis Silvestri, 1895
- Paracryptops indicus Silvestri, 1924
- Paracryptops inexpectus Chamberlin, 1914
- Paracryptops spinosus Jangi & Dass, 1978
- Paracryptops weberi Pocock, 1891
